Judge
Harriet
Lansing
Court of Appeals
Minnesota Judicial Center Phone: (651) 297-7650
Appointed/Elected:
Appointed November 1, 1983. Elected 1984, 1990, 1996, 2002 and 2008. Her current term expires in January 2015.
Education:
University of Minnesota Law School (J.D. 1970); Macalester College (B.A. 1967).
Employment Background:
Judge, Ramsey County Municipal Court (1978-1983); St. Paul City Attorney (1976-78); Private Practice (1973-76); Assistant City Attorney 1972-73); Staff Counsel, St. Paul Housing and Redevelopment Authority (1970-72).
Bar Admissions:
Minnesota Supreme Court (1970); Federal District Court, District of Minnesota (1971); Eighth Circuit Court of Appeals (1976); United States Supreme Court (1987).
Teaching and Related Law School Activities:
Faculty member of New York University Law School’s Appellate Institute 1999-2003; Adjunct Professor William Mitchell College of Law 2002-2003 (teaching state constitutional law), 1978-1981 (teaching trial skills); Adjunct Professor Hamline Law School 1990-92; William Mitchell Diversity Program 1990; William Mitchell Minority Employment Program 1991; University of Minnesota Law School Board of Visitors, Chair 1990-92; University of Minnesota Law School Committee to Determine Class Size 1985; and University of Minnesota Endowed Chair Selection Committee 1988-91.
Professional Organizations:
National Conference of Commissioners on Uniform State Laws (1994-present), executive committee (2001-2003) and Committees to Redraft Limited Liability Companies Act, Limited Partnership Act, and Uniform Certification of Questions of Law; Supreme Court Gender Fairness Task Force, Vice Chair 1986-89; National Center for State Courts Committee to Reduce Appellate Delay (1987-1989); Fellow, American Bar Foundation (1992-current); Warren Burger Inns of Court (1992-93); Minnesota Institute for Legal Education Advisory Committee (1985-89); Supreme Court Continuing Education for Judges (1983-88); National Association of Women Judges, Board of Directors (1981-83), Education Chair for National Conference (1987); National Conference of Special Court Judges (1972-83), Delegate to National Convention 1979, 1982, Minnesota Judicial Academy, Criminal Curriculum Committee; American Bar Association (1970-present); Minnesota State Bar Association (1970-present), Chair, Long-Range Planning Committee (1979-83); Minnesota Bar Foundation (1978-81), Secretary/Treasurer (1979-81); Ramsey County Bar Association (1970-present), served on various committees including Ethics Committee and Jurisprudence and Law Reform; American Judges Association; American Judicature Society; Ramsey County Judges Association; American Interprofessional Institute.
Community Organizations:
Judge Lansing has served on a number of community boards and committees, including the Ramsey County league of Local Governments Study Commission on Court Consolidation, Crime Victims Center Advisory Board, Corrections Advisory Board, Family Service of St. Paul, YMCA Camp Widjiwagan Board of Directors, Ramsey County Juvenile Center Building Committee, St. Paul Chamber Orchestra (vice president and six years on executive committee). She has served on various selection committees including MEA Teacher of the Year, Frank Premack Journalism Award, Warren Burger Scholarship Committee, and Rhodes Scholar Selection Committee (Minnesota chair 1986-87).
Other Teaching and Lecturing Activities:
Frequent lecturer on judicial and legal education, including appellate advocacy seminars, Minnesota Constitution seminars, housing law seminars, Robert A. Taft Institute of Government Seminar, National Practice Institute, American Judicature Society, Minnesota Administrators Academy, Center for International Leadership. Judge Lansing has received distinguished service awards from Macalester College, the University of Minnesota Law School, the St. Paul Jaycees, and the Y.W.C.A.
Published Materials:
Rosalie E. Wahl and the Jurisprudence of Inclusivity, 21 William Mitchell Law Review 11 (Fall 1995); Co-Author, The Preparation and Presentation of a Claim Based on the Minnesota Constitution, Government Liability Institute (Minnesota State Bar Association, 1993); Gender Fairness Task Force Report 15 William Mitchell Law Review 827 (1989).
